Understanding Remote Car Keys
Remote car keys work through radio frequency signals sent in between the key fob and the vehicle's immobilizer system. Depending upon the kind of remote key, it may serve functions such as opening doors, starting the engine, or perhaps opening the trunk. Some modern vehicles featured wise keys that provide even more advanced functions, including proximity entry technology.
Types of Remote Car KeysConventional Key Fobs: These are fundamental push-button controls that unlock or lock the car doors and may begin the engine.Smart Keys: These keys utilize RFID technology and permit keyless entry and starting.Flip Keys: These keys fold into themselves and frequently consist of a remote part.Keyless Entry Systems: These systems do not have conventional keys. Rather, they allow gain access to through proximity sensing units.Factors Influencing Key Replacement Costs
The expense of replacing a remote car key can vary substantially. Below are the main aspects that affect costs:
FactorDescriptionType of VehicleLuxury or high-end automobiles may cost more to replace.Type of KeySmart keys are typically more costly than traditional fobs.Dealer vs. Third PartyDealers usually charge more compared to locksmiths.Programming RequirementsSome keys need customized shows, increasing expense.PlaceUrban locations might have greater price varieties than rural ones.Cost BreakdownFundamental Key Fob Replacement: ₤ 50 - ₤ 150Advanced Smart Key Replacement: ₤ 200 - ₤ 400Configuring Fee: ₤ 50 - ₤ 100 (if applicable)Emergency Lockout Service: ₤ 75 - ₤ 150 (if needed on-site)How to Find Remote Car Key Replacement Services Near You

Regularly Asked Questions1. Can any locksmith professional replace my remote key?
Most qualified locksmiths can replace car key Fob (http://101.35.233.40) remote keys, however it's vital to confirm they have the best devices for your particular key type.
2. For how long does it require to get a remote key replaced?
Replacement services can typically take anywhere from 20 minutes to a couple of hours, depending on the complexity of the key and the availability of parts.
3. Do I need my car to replace a remote key?
Yes, you normally need to have your vehicle present for configuring the new key, as it should be synced to the car's electronic system.
4. What should I do if my remote key stopped working?
If your key fob is not reacting, it might be due to a dead battery, a defective key, or an issue with the car's receiver. It's best to consult an expert locksmith professional or dealership.
5. Can I replace a remote car key myself?
While DIY packages exist, they may not work as dependably as professional services. Self-replacement can cause compatibility concerns or need further programming.
